Transaction 523bdc12c4e84376aeeba6797870d0f587c32a1b2cc02d9fe49a3ab406d4a9ee
1 Input
2 Outputs
- 523bdc12c4e84376aeeba6797870d0f587c32a1b2cc02d9fe49a3ab406d4a9ee:0
- 523bdc12c4e84376aeeba6797870d0f587c32a1b2cc02d9fe49a3ab406d4a9ee:1
value 12328
address 1EsVpDuaXy5FcPdQzYnhj6f648qn2H94Nr
value 90462
address 12h11PWmQXCMc3uN4M492Ff4FcWPD6hH5W